> > > I still don't think we should get rid of the WAS_FAST stuff.
> >
> > I do :-)
> >
> > > The assumption that the L1 VM will almost never share pages between L2
> > > VMs is questionable. The real question becomes: do we care to have
> > > accurate age information for this case? I think so.
> >
> > I think you're conflating two different things.  WAS_FAST isn't about accuracy,
> > it's about supporting lookaround in conditionally fast secondary MMUs.
> >
> > Accuracy only comes into play when we're talking about the last-minute check,
> > which, IIUC, has nothing to do with WAS_FAST because any potential lookaround has
> > already been performed.
> 
> Sorry, I thought you meant: have the MMU notifier only ever be
> lockless (when tdp_mmu_enabled), and just return a potentially wrong
> result in the unlikely case that L1 is sharing pages between L2s.
> 
> I think it's totally fine to just drop WAS_FAST. So then we can either
> do look-around (1) always, or (2) only when there is a secondary MMU
> with has_fast_aging. (2) is pretty simple, I'll just do that.
> 
> We can add some shadow MMU lockless support later to make the
> look-around not as useless for the nested TDP case.

> 1. Drop the WAS_FAST complexity.
> 2. Add a function like mm_has_fast_aging_notifiers(), use that to
> determine if we should be doing look-around.

I would prefer a flag over a function.  Long-term, if my pseudo-lockless rmap
idea pans out, KVM can set the flag during VM creation.  Until then, KVM can set
the flag during creation and then toggle it in (un)account_shadowed().  Races
will be possible, but they should be extremely rare and quite benign, all things
considered.
